@charset "gb2312";
/*
 * NEWSLESHAN v1.0.0 (http://www.leshan.cn)
 * Copyright 2011-2014 ÀÖÉ½ÐÂÎÅÍø, Inc. 
*/

body,ul,li,h1,h2,h3,h4,h5,span,dl,dd,dt{ margin:0;padding:0; list-style:none}
img{ border:none}
a{ font-size:14px; color:#333; text-decoration:none;}
@font-face {
  font-family: 'Glyphicons Halflings';
  src: url('fontsglyphicons-halflings-regular.eot');
  src: url('fontsglyphicons-halflings-regular.eotiefix') format('embedded-opentype'), url('fontsglyphicons-halflings-regular.woff') format('woff'), url('fontsglyphicons-halflings-regular.ttf') format('truetype'), url('../fonts/glyphicons-halflings-regular.svg#glyphicons_halflingsregular') format('svg');
}
body{ background:url(imgbg.jpg) no-repeat center 24px; }
.bd{ border:1px solid #ddd}
.t_nav{ height:28px; background-color:#fff; line-height:28px;}
.t_nav .logo { float:left; }
.t_navF{ float:left; height:28px}
.t_navF span{ padding:0px 10px}
.gz{ float:right; }
.clear{ zoom:1;}
.clear:after { content:"."; display:block; height:0; visibility:hidden; clear:both; }    
.md{ width:980px; margin:0 auto}
.main{ margin-top:6px}
.nav{ background-color:#efeff0; margin-top:338px; text-align:center}
.nav .md{height:54px;word-spacing:1em; line-height:54px;}
.nav .md a{ font-size:18px; font-weight:bold; color:#c9161d;}
 
.ml{ width:398px; height:610px; float:left;}
.mm{ width:340px; height:610px; float:left; margin-left:0px; margin-left:2px; display:inline}
.mr{ width:232px; height:610px; float:right; } 

.flash{ height:276px; padding:8px}
.pl{ background-color:#efeff0; margin-top:2px; height:316px}

.bj{ padding:15px 14px}
.title{ padding:0px 14px}

.zyjs,.ssjs,.swjs{ height:200px}
.ssjs,.swjs{ margin-top:3px}
.title2{ padding:10px 5px 8px 14px }
.ad{ margin-top:3px; margin-bottom:3px}


.gjc{ }
.nr{padding:14px; height:600px}
.nr1{padding:14px;}
.redh{ background-color:#c9161d; height:5px; overflow:hidden; clear:both}

.ts{ margin-top:4px}
.bj dt a{ font-size:18px; color:#5c83ae}
.bj dd a{ font-size:12px; color:#010101}
.bj dd { padding-bottom:5px}
.bj dt { padding-top:5px}

.mr a{ font-size:12px} 

.nr a{ line-height:24px; font-size:12px; color:#8c8c8c}










/*yx_rotaion*/
.yx-rotaion{margin:0 auto;}
.yx-rotaion-btn,.yx-rotaion-title,.yx-rotation-focus,.yx-rotation-t,.yx-rotaion-btn{position:absolute}
.yx-rotation-title{position:absolute;width:100%;height:40px;line-height:40px;background:#000;filter:alpha(opacity=40);-moz-opacity:0.4;-khtml-opacity:0.4;opacity:0.4;left:0;bottom:0;_bottom:-1px;z-index:1}
.yx-rotation-t{color:#fff;font-size:16px;font-family:microsoft yahei;z-index:2;bottom:0;left:10px;line-height:40px}
.yx-rotation-focus span,.yx-rotaion-btn span{background:url(www.leshan.cncssico.png) no-repeat;display:block;}
.yx-rotation-focus{height:40px;line-height:40px;right:20px;bottom:0;z-index:2}
.yx-rotation-focus span{width:12px;height:12px;line-height:12px;float:left;margin-left:5px;position:relative;top:14px;cursor:pointer;background-position:-24px -126px;text-indent:-9999px}
.yx-rotaion-btn{width:100%;height:41px;top:50%;margin-top:-20px;}
.yx-rotaion-btn span{width:41px;height:41px;cursor:pointer;filter:alpha(opacity=30);-moz-opacity:0.3;-khtml-opacity:0.3;opacity:0.3;position:relative}
.yx-rotaion-btn .left_btn{background-position:-2px -2px;float:left;left:10px}
.yx-rotaion-btn .right_btn{background-position:-2px -49px;float:right;right:10px}
.yx-rotaion-btn span.hover{filter:alpha(opacity=80);-moz-opacity:0.8;-khtml-opacity:0.8;opacity:0.8}
.yx-rotation-focus span.hover{background-position:-10px -126px}
.rotaion_list{width:0;height:0;overflow:hidden;}
.tab_con1 li{ float:left;  margin-left:5px; list-style:none; display:inline}
.tab_con1 li img{ padding:3px; border:1px solid #ddd;  }